Output 334c185335338f3fe66b77148be163685344da5273a9c95f98476b0333ac913a:0

value
50200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ec53c52cd73af3b49d3b23e0c3e943552bac863 OP_EQUAL
address
9vha2PMwEo8kDNF45LGKVNYCkqKFJTjRxb
transaction
334c185335338f3fe66b77148be163685344da5273a9c95f98476b0333ac913a